How to Install and Uninstall plymouth-plugin-two-step Package on openSuSE Tumbleweed

Last updated: May 19,2024

1. Install "plymouth-plugin-two-step" package

Here is a brief guide to show you how to install plymouth-plugin-two-step on openSuSE Tumbleweed

$ sudo zypper refresh $ sudo zypper install plymouth-plugin-two-step

2. Uninstall "plymouth-plugin-two-step" package

This guide let you learn how to uninstall plymouth-plugin-two-step on openSuSE Tumbleweed:

$ sudo zypper remove plymouth-plugin-two-step

Summary : Plymouth "two-step" plugin
Description :
This package contains the "two-step" boot splash plugin for
Plymouth. It features a two phased boot process that starts with
a progressing animation synced to boot time and finishes with a
short, fast one-shot animation.
